Power of Money

by | Jan 30, 2018 | Poetry | 10 comments

 

The most dominant creation of human

Neither a robot nor a spaceship

You may think of planes and medicines

But oh dear, can they exist without me?

 

 

 

It’s amazing how a piece of paper

Is the supreme power in this world

It’s wondrous how human created something

That’s more valuable than himself

 

 

 

Some value me more than emotions

Some merit me more than life

Some worship me more than God

Which class do you fit in?

 

 

 

Greed, hunger, murder, poverty

Rage, failure, frustration, politics

All the negativities in this world

Can certainly be attributed to me

 

 

 

Imagine a world with dominion of love

Envision a world ruled by feelings

Picture a world of gratitude and selflessness

Imagine a world where man aced money!
